引言
《穿越火线》(CrossFire)作为一款全球知名的第一人称射击游戏,自2008年发布以来,吸引了无数玩家。它以其丰富的游戏模式、精美的画面和紧张刺激的射击体验,成为了射击游戏领域的佼佼者。本文将揭秘《穿越火线》背后的故事,并分享一些提升射击技巧的方法。
背后的故事
游戏起源
《穿越火线》由韩国Smilegate Entertainment公司开发,最初是一款名为《CrossFire: Reloaded》的射击游戏。游戏在2007年发布,很快因其独特的游戏体验和精美的画面获得了玩家们的喜爱。
国内外发展
2008年,《穿越火线》进入中国市场,并迅速获得了巨大的成功。随后,游戏在全球范围内推广,成为了一款国际化的射击游戏。
游戏特色
- 丰富的游戏模式:《穿越火线》提供了多种游戏模式,包括团队死亡竞赛、团队夺旗、爆破模式等,满足了不同玩家的需求。
- 精美的画面:游戏采用了先进的图形引擎,画面精美细腻,给玩家带来了沉浸式的游戏体验。
- 紧张的射击体验:游戏操作简单,射击手感流畅,让玩家能够在游戏中尽情享受射击的快感。
射击技巧
基础技巧
- 瞄准:掌握正确的瞄准技巧是提高射击水平的关键。玩家应该学会调整准星,使瞄准点与目标保持一致。
- 射击节奏:保持稳定的射击节奏,避免连续射击导致枪械后坐力过大,影响射击精度。
高级技巧
- 预判:在游戏中,预判敌人的移动方向和射击时机,可以大大提高命中率。
- 利用地图:熟悉游戏地图,了解各个区域的优劣,可以更好地利用地形优势。
- 团队配合:在团队游戏中,与队友保持良好的沟通,协同作战,才能取得胜利。
举例说明
以下是一个简单的射击代码示例,用于说明如何调整枪械后坐力:
// 假设有一个枪械类,其中包含后坐力属性
class Gun {
public:
float recoil; // 后坐力
// 构造函数
Gun(float r) : recoil(r) {}
// 射击函数
void shoot() {
// ...射击逻辑...
recoil += 0.1f; // 每次射击后增加后坐力
}
};
// 创建一个枪械实例
Gun myGun(0.5f);
// 射击三次
myGun.shoot();
myGun.shoot();
myGun.shoot();
// 查看射击后的后坐力
std::cout << "射击后的后坐力:" << myGun.recoil << std::endl;
通过以上代码,我们可以看到每次射击都会使枪械后坐力增加,这对于玩家来说,需要不断调整射击节奏,以保持射击精度。
总结
《穿越火线》作为一款经典的射击游戏,凭借其丰富的游戏内容和精美的画面,吸引了无数玩家。通过本文的介绍,相信大家对《穿越火线》有了更深入的了解,同时也能掌握一些提升射击技巧的方法。希望这些信息能帮助你在游戏中取得更好的成绩!
